What does a life coaching certification online involve?

A life coaching certification online typically covers core coaching skills such as active listening, powerful questioning, goal setting, and accountability. You can expect a mix of video lessons, live virtual classes, practice coaching sessions, and written assignments. Many programs also include supervised practice, where you coach real or simulated clients while receiving structured feedback from experienced trainers.

Accreditation and curriculum depth both matter. Some courses follow established professional standards and offer clear competency frameworks, while others are more informal. When comparing options, pay attention to the total training hours, opportunities for practice, mentor coaching or supervision, and whether you will receive ongoing support after you complete the program. These elements can make a significant difference in how prepared you feel when you start working with clients.

How does career coaching for professionals fit in?

Career coaching for professionals focuses on work-related goals such as role changes, promotions, transitions between industries, or re-entering the workforce. Within an online life coaching path, this specialization blends general coaching skills with tools for career assessment, networking strategies, and interview preparation. Programs may teach you how to help clients clarify strengths, values, and interests, and then translate those insights into concrete career plans.

This specialization can be useful if you have experience in corporate settings, human resources, or leadership. Online courses often include case studies based on real workplace challenges and may cover topics like navigating organizational politics or handling burnout. As you review programs, look for content on career strategy, labor market trends, and ethics around coaching within organizational environments.

What is included in an executive coaching program?

An executive coaching program is usually designed for working with senior leaders, managers, and high-potential professionals. These online certifications emphasize advanced communication skills, leadership frameworks, and systems thinking. You may learn methods for supporting executives with challenges like leading change, managing complex teams, improving emotional intelligence, or sharpening strategic decision-making.

Compared with general life coaching training, executive-focused programs often include material on organizational culture, stakeholder management, and performance metrics. Some also introduce assessment tools for leadership styles or personality patterns. If you are considering this path, it is helpful to check whether a program offers opportunities to practice with leadership-focused scenarios and whether instructors have direct experience working with executives or within organizations.

Choosing a personal development coaching course

A personal development coaching course centers on helping clients improve overall life satisfaction, mindset, habits, and resilience. This type of online certification often appeals to people drawn to self-improvement topics such as motivation, confidence, and life balance. The curriculum may explore methods for identifying limiting beliefs, building new routines, and creating sustainable change through small, consistent actions.

When evaluating these courses, consider how they integrate theory and practice. Look for clear guidance on structuring sessions, tracking progress, and setting ethical boundaries between coaching and therapy. Many programs also touch on positive psychology and strengths-based approaches. It can be useful to choose training that encourages you to apply the tools to your own life as you learn, so you can speak from direct experience when working with future clients.

Options for wellness coaching training

Wellness coaching training connects coaching skills with topics related to lifestyle, stress management, and overall well-being. While wellness coaches do not diagnose or treat medical conditions, they often support clients in areas like movement, sleep routines, nutrition habits, and work-life balance, always within appropriate ethical and professional limits. Online programs in this area usually emphasize motivational interviewing, habit formation, and collaboration with other health or wellness professionals when needed.

Because wellness can touch on sensitive health-related topics, it is especially important that training highlights scope of practice, consent, and referral guidelines. As you compare programs, check whether they address working with diverse clients, cultural perspectives on health, and inclusive language. High-quality wellness coaching courses also encourage you to reflect on your own well-being practices, since your personal example can influence how clients experience the coaching relationship.
